HOST: Welcome to our podcast, today we're talking with an expert about the exciting field of Internet of Things in Vehicles. Can you tell us a bit about this certification and its relevance in today's automotive industry? GUEST: Absolutely, this Certified Professional in Internet of Things (IoT) in Vehicles course is designed for automotive professionals and engineers who want to gain expertise in vehicle telematics, connected car technologies, and IoT security. It's a rapidly evolving sector, and staying current with data analytics, cloud computing, and embedded systems is crucial. HOST: That sounds fascinating. Can you share any interesting trends you've noticed in the automotive IoT space recently? GUEST: Sure! In-vehicle networks and over-the-air updates are becoming increasingly important. Also, sensor integration is a hot topic, as it can significantly enhance vehicle performance and safety. HOST: Those sound like challenging yet rewarding areas. What would you say are some common challenges faced when implementing or learning about automotive IoT? GUEST: One major challenge is keeping up with the rapid pace of innovation. Security is another concern, as IoT in vehicles presents unique vulnerabilities that must be addressed. HOST: Indeed, security is paramount in today's interconnected world. Looking towards the future, where do you see the automotive IoT sector heading? GUEST: I believe we'll see more sophisticated data-driven services, increased electrification, and the rise of self-driving vehicles. All these trends will rely heavily on IoT technologies and expertise. HOST: It's an exciting time to be involved in this industry, for sure.
